The model number can also be found on the back panel of your TV. On some Samsung TV models, the serial number will be located near the model number. If you cannot find this number, you can look up the information using the software on your television. Alternatively, you can look up the information via the Internet. To do this, turn on your TV and go to the menu option, support, and then choose ‘About This TV.’ A window will open up where you can find the model number and software version.

Is My Samsung TV 4K?
There are many ways to find out if your Samsung TV is 4K, and one of them is to check the manual. The manual should have a section with the model number and information on resolution. If the manual does not list the resolution, try looking for it online. You can also try looking at pictures of the TV’s resolution. It may take a couple of tries to find the correct spot.
The next step is to check the settings of your Samsung TV. The information will give you some basic details about the resolution. You can look for things such as 4K, UHD, 3840 x 2160, etc. You can also check the picture quality using images or plain text.
If your Samsung TV isn’t labeled as 4K, try changing the resolution in the settings menu. You can also test its resolution by using the YouTube app. You should see an option for “2160p”. You can also use OTT apps that offer 4K content. Watch movies and shows on these platforms and you should be able to see them in their highest resolutions.

What Makes a TV a Smart TV?
A smart TV is one that incorporates a wide variety of digital content and services. Most of these services are free or inexpensive and can be downloaded to a TV via a web browser. A smart TV can also perform tasks such as executing games or other applications. Some even come with built-in QWERTY keyboards.
A smart TV is also likely to have voice control capabilities. These TVs can use voice recognition software to control other connected home devices. The most advanced models have voice search capabilities, which allow users to search content on live television through their voice. In addition, they can perform other tasks like checking the weather, stock prices, and celebrity gossip. Some smart TVs can even integrate with smart speakers.
To determine whether a smart TV is truly smart, start by comparing its features. Most manufacturers offer software updates for their smart TVs regularly, adding new features and improving old ones. Updates also resolve security problems and bug fixes. Some are entirely new, while others are only minor tweaks to the internal firmware.
